At the Junction of Reality and Illusion

 

The time I have been hinting at has come. The universal work weighs tremendously on me. Maya, the principle of ignorance, in full power tries to oppose my Work. So, particularly those who live near me must be very watchful. Knowing my love for you, Maya awaits an opportunity to use your weaknesses. The moment you neglect my instructions, Maya’s purpose is served. I have to put up a fight with Maya—not to destroy it, but to make you aware of its nothingness. The moment you fail to obey me implicitly it tightens its grip over you and you fail to carry out the duties given. This adds to my suffering.

In God there is no such thing as confusion—God is infinite Bliss and Honesty. In Illusion there is confusion, misery and chaos. As the eternal Redeemer of humanity, I am at the junction of Reality and Illusion, simultaneously experiencing the infinite bliss of Reality and the suffering of Illusion.

With Reality on the one hand and Illusion on the other, I constantly experience as it were, a pull on either side. This is my crucifixion. When you fall a prey to the persuasions of Maya, the pull of Illusion is intensified and I have to exert myself to withstand it and remain stationed at the junction. I do not ever let go my hold on Reality. If the pull of Illusion becomes too great my arm may be pulled out of its socket, but I will remain where I am.

-The Everything and the Nothing, p67
